About Us

The Latter-Day Saints Student Association (LDSSA) is offering a Gospel Study / Institute of Religion class meetings on campus open to all student and those who wish to learn more about God and Jesus Christ, seek to study the scriptures, the Bible, and the Book of Mormon, and gain a greater understanding and appreciation of the principles and doctrine within the scriptures. Free lunch is provided each week (deli meat sandwiches, chips, juice) by the instructor.
